Biochemical and genetic analysis of 3-methylglutaconic aciduria type IV: a diagnostic strategy.
Brain : a journal of neurology - 1 Jan 2009
Wortmann Saskia B, Rodenburg Richard J T, Jonckheere An, de Vries Maaike C, Huizing Marjan, Heldt Katrin, van den Heuvel Lambert P, Wendel Udo, Kluijtmans Leo A, Engelke Udo F, Wevers Ron A, Smeitink Jan A M, Morava Eva
Abstract excerpt
The heterogeneous group of 3-methylglutaconic aciduria type IV consists of patients with various organ involvement and mostly progressive neurological impairment in combination with 3-methylglutaconic aciduria and biochemical features of dysfunctional oxidative phosphorylation.
